Views: Visits 75 The Federal Capital Territory Administration (FCTA), in collaboration with security agencies, have deployed about 100 personnel to arrest traffic flow violators. Mr Wadata Bodinga, Director, Directorate of Road Traffic Services (DRTS) in the FCTA, stated this on Monday during an inspection visit to a mobile court set up to prosecute traffic offenders in the FCT. The Streetjournal reports that the Minister of FCT, Muhammad Bello, on Feb.26 flagged-off a ministerial action against traffic violation. The ministerial taskforce team comprises of men of the Nigeria Police Force, Directorate of Road Traffic Services, Federal Road Safety Corps and the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ps.

Vanguard News Translate Former FRSC boss, Osita Chidoka, writes open letter to new EFCC Chairman Bawa On Abdulrasheed Bawa The former Federal Road Safety Corps, FRSC, Marshall, Chief Osita Chidoka has written an open letter to the newly appointed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, chairman, Abdulrasheed Bawa. The letter contained a congratulatory message to the new EFCC sheriff and some success nuggets. Chief Osita said that he decided to write the new anti-corruption boss because he shares some similarity with the trajectory of the new kid on the block. Recall that Abdulrasheed Bawa was on February 24 appointed the Chairman of EFCC by President Muhamadu Buhari.
